2 Star 8 Fork 1

Mr丶冷文 / lw-admin

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
贡献代码
同步代码
取消
提示: 由于 Git 不支持空文件夾,创建文件夹后会生成空的 .keep 文件
Loading...
README

lw-admin

一个基于Vue+elementUI的多iframe窗口后端模板

下载

预览

预览地址: 点此预览

说明

虽然已经用过不少优秀基于elementUI的后台模板, 但是大多数都是配合webpack使用的SPA, 这对于从来没有接触过webpack的同学来说不是很友好, 而且很多后端程序员在写前端的时候都比较喜欢拿一份纯静态页面来改, 所以SPA或者使用webpack构件的项目对他们来说确实不太友好, 于是在经过激烈的思想斗争后,决定自己写一个简单的管理模板。 用到的东西不多,适合小白参考,大佬绕过,不喜勿喷,谢谢

简介

  • 架构: 基于iframe,纯HTML,舍弃了webpack,让一些前端不太友好的后端程序员也可以轻易使用
  • 菜单: 支持二级菜单,菜单可折叠为竖排图标,菜单格式
    [{
        id: 2, //菜单唯一标识
        name: '权限控制',
        icon: 'fa fa-paper-plane', //图标,支持Font Awesome图标
        info: '对系统角色权限的分配等设计,敏感度较高,请谨慎授权',//菜单说明
        //子菜单列表
        childList: [
            {
                id: '2-1',
                name: '角色列表',
                url: 'permission/role.html',//对应打开iframe的URL
                parentId: 2
            },
            {
                id: '2-2',
                name: '菜单列表',
                url: 'permission/menu.html',
                parentId: 2
            }
        ],
        parentId: 0 //父菜单id,0表示该菜单为顶级菜单
    },
    {...}]
    • 菜单预览 展开 折叠
  • 基础: 只需要会一点前端基础就可以了,大家完全可以参考elementUI官方文档照猫画虎
  • 交互: 前后端交互用ajax即可,本项目使用jQuery发送ajax请求而不是axios,这也是考虑到很多人没有用过axios
  • markdown支持: 本项目利用国产开源框架Editor.md实现Markdown相关功能,具体用法请参考Editor.md官网
    • 预览
  • 数据报表: 作为一款后端管理模板,怎么能少得了数据报表呢?本项目整合了开源报表框架echart,操作简单,具体用法请参考echart官方文档
    • 预览
  • 权限相关:
    • 为用户分配角色
    • 为角色分配权限
  • 其他页面:
    • 菜单列表
    • 登录页
    • 错误页
    • 更多页面请下载后预览

空文件

简介

虽然已经用过不少优秀基于elementUI的后台模板, 但是大多数都是配合webpack使用的SPA, 这对于从来没有接触过webpack的同学来说不是很友好, 而且很多后端程序员在写前端的时候都比较喜欢拿一份纯静态页面来改, 所以SPA或者使用webpack构件的项目对他们来说确实不太友好, 于是在经过激烈的思想斗争后,决定自己写一个简单的管理模板。 用到的东西不多,适合小白参考,大佬绕过,不喜勿喷,谢谢 展开 收起
JavaScript
取消

发行版

暂无发行版

贡献者

全部

近期动态

加载更多
不能加载更多了
JavaScript
1
https://gitee.com/kevinlu98/lw-admin.git
git@gitee.com:kevinlu98/lw-admin.git
kevinlu98
lw-admin
lw-admin
master

搜索帮助